What does terrorist mean?
Definitions in simple English

terrorist

A terrorist is a person who uses terror and violence to get political change. The car bomb at the busy market was the work of a terrorist.

terrorist

a radical who employs terror as a political weapon; usually organizes with other terrorists in small cells; often uses religion as a cover for terrorist activities
